The Jerusalem Council
19 Therefore my judgment is that we do not trouble those who have turned to God from among the nations, 20 but that we write to them that they should abstain from pollutions of idols, and from fornication, and from things strangled, and from blood. 21 For Moses from ages past has those in every city proclaiming him, being read in the synagogues every sabbath day.
